Why this blog?

I've lived here for over four years. This is my fifth American Football* season. Each season, by about January, I think I'm getting the hang of it. Then I try talking to someone at work about hey, aren't those Saints doing well? or something that I thought was similarly innocuous and within 30 seconds I've made an arse of myself and I'm back to thinking nasty thoughts about what pansies the Yanks are that they enjoy watching men run around in shiny lycra with more pads and armour than menstruating dinosaurs. That's a horrible image. And I don't want to be that person -- I CHOSE to live in this country, after all.

The aim of this blog is to help me, and any other Brits out there who share the simple goal of being able to have a half-informed conversation around the ubiquitous office water cooler without sounding like a total twat. Seems like a simple goal, but it's one that's eluded me for years. I hope that by enlisting the help of some friends, and friends of friends, and maybe -- eventually -- even some readers, I may know more about American football by next season than I do now. I'll let you know how it goes...



* For my mental health, I intend to refer to the sport as American Football in all my posts. Guest bloggers may not. But hey, why make a blog about this complicated game any easier to understand?
